Mobile home fire displaces family of 4 in Altoona

Thursday, May 7, 2015
Emily Van Ort, Internet Director WQOW

Altoona (WQOW) - A family of four, including two kids, lost their home to a fire early Thursday morning in Altoona. 

Firefighters got the call around 2 a.m. to a home on Rosebud Lane in the Hillcrest Estates Mobile Home Park. The family escaped, but one man burned his hands trying to put out the fire. 

Fire officials are looking into whether a cigarette butt in a can, on the wooden porch, started the fire. Firefighters were called back to the scene twice Thursday morning when strong winds rekindled the fire.
